How Tall Is Carli Lloyd in Feet, Meters, and Comparative Context

Carli Lloyd Height in Official Records

Carli Lloyd is listed at 5 feet 8 inches tall, which equals approximately 1.73 meters based on the most recent public profiles from U.S. Soccer and major sports databases ussoccer.com. This height places her in the upper range for female professional soccer players in the United States.

The 5 foot 8 inches measurement has remained consistent across her career and is widely cited in federation profiles, media guides, and team rosters. This figure is used for official match listings, broadcast graphics, and fantasy sports platforms that track player physical attributes.

Height in Context of Professional Soccer

At 5 foot 8 inches, Lloyd is taller than the average female professional player in top domestic leagues, where many central midfielders and forwards range between 5 feet 4 inches and 5 feet 7 inches nbcsports.com. Her height contributes to aerial ability, long-range shooting leverage, and physical presence in the box.

Compared to other prominent U.S. women's national team players, Lloyd's height is above average but not at the extreme end, as some center backs and target forwards exceed 5 feet 10 inches. Her frame supports a playing style that combines technical finishing with physical durability across multiple Olympic and World Cup cycles.
